    Running costs for an EV depend significantly on whether you can charge at home.  Costs for an EV can run from as little as 3p per mile or as much as 50p per mile from an overpriced public rapid charger.

    You don’t need to pay the highest price for an EV, the Enyaq is 5 grand cheaper and the Megane is cheaper still for its top spec model below 1 grand.  When you take the huge Enyaq 80 for £2,899 and try to find a similarly sized ICE (karoq?) the up front costs aren’t that far apart but whether fuel costs are a significant factor depends entirely on your mileage.
